The Baofeng UV-5R is the clear winner for most users due to its exceptional value proposition and proven reliability. Despite the Radtel's higher overall score, the UV-5R's massive price advantage of $79 makes it the smarter choice for beginners and budget-conscious operators.
The single most important differentiator is price versus features. The UV-5R costs one-sixth as much while delivering established performance, CHIRP compatibility for easy programming, and solid 5W transmission. The Radtel adds APRS and GPS capabilities but at a premium, with incomplete specifications that raise reliability concerns.
The UV-5R suits anyone entering amateur radio on a budget or wanting a backup radio with proven longevity and an active user community. The Radtel appeals to operators specifically needing GPS and APRS functionality who can afford the higher cost and are willing to accept less documented performance data.
For the vast majority of amateur radio enthusiasts, the Baofeng UV-5R remains the better purchase. You're paying for unnecessary features with the Radtel when the UV-5R provides superior value and a track record spanning years of user feedback and support.

Reasons to choose Baofeng UV-5R
- 81% cheaper ($15.97 vs $83.16)
- Has CHIRP compatibility
- FCC equipment authorization on file
Reasons to choose Radtel RT-880G
- 100% more TX power (10W vs 5W)
- 8x more memory channels (1,024 vs 128)
- 33% more battery (2400 mAh vs 1800 mAh)
- Has APRS support
- Has built-in GPS
